The Role of WalletConnect (WCT) in Staking on the WalletConnect Network
Staking has become a cornerstone of blockchain ecosystems, enabling users to participate in network validation and earn rewards. WalletConnect (WCT), a decentralized protocol, plays a pivotal role in simplifying and securing the staking process by bridging the gap between wallets and decentralized applications (dApps). This article explores the multifaceted role of WCT in staking, highlighting its contributions to security, user experience, scalability, and community engagement.
Understanding WalletConnect (WCT) and Staking
WalletConnect is an open-source protocol that facilitates secure communication between blockchain wallets and dApps. It eliminates the need for centralized intermediaries, ensuring that users retain full control over their funds. Staking, on the other hand, involves locking up cryptocurrency to support network operations, such as transaction validation and block creation. Validators are rewarded with additional tokens for their participation, making staking an attractive option for earning passive income.
The Role of WCT in Staking
1. Secure Connection and Authentication
WCT ensures that staking activities begin with a secure and authenticated connection between a user’s wallet and a staking dApp. By leveraging end-to-end encryption, WCT prevents unauthorized access, safeguarding users' funds throughout the staking process. This is particularly critical in DeFi, where security breaches can lead to significant financial losses.
2. Enhanced User Experience
Staking can be complex for newcomers, but WCT simplifies the process. Users can seamlessly connect their wallets to multiple staking platforms without managing separate accounts or credentials. This frictionless experience encourages broader participation in staking, democratizing access to blockchain rewards.
3. Robust Security Measures
WCT’s decentralized architecture minimizes risks associated with centralized control, such as single points of failure. Additionally, it supports hardware wallets, which provide an extra layer of security for staking activities. Recent updates, like improved authentication mechanisms, further bolster its security framework.
4. Scalability for High Demand
As staking gains popularity, networks must handle increasing transaction volumes. WCT’s protocol is designed for scalability, ensuring stable performance even during peak activity. This reliability is essential for maintaining user trust and network integrity.
5. Fostering Community Engagement
By making staking more accessible, WCT empowers users to actively participate in blockchain governance and validation. A vibrant, engaged community strengthens network security and decentralization, aligning with the ethos of Web3.
Recent Developments and Future Outlook
WCT has expanded its support to include major networks like Solana and Cosmos, broadening staking opportunities for users. Regular security updates and a focus on user adoption have solidified its reputation as a trusted protocol. However, the evolving regulatory landscape and competitive DeFi environment pose challenges. WCT must continue innovating—for example, by integrating with emerging networks or enhancing cross-chain capabilities—to maintain its leadership in the staking ecosystem.
